Does anybody have these specs handy? I have the original 590 specs, and the 590ps2 specs, but not the 590ps specs. Thanks

rigidthumper

My notes show the advertised specs for 590 & the 590PS the same- Intake 22/44, 246°,.590",  Exhaust 48/20, 244°, .590" lift. The ramp rate (lifter intensity) 3.89 for the 590PS, and 4.05 for the 590.

tdrglide

I'm seeing the 590 PS2 cams as IN, 23/43, 246, 590 lift,  EX, 55/15, 250, 590 lift. This is from spec sheet on his website

tdrglide

The older 590 were as ridgidthumper says. I think he made a ramp change along the way with those too. People complained about noise. I didn't.
